Factors Influencing the Price of Chevy Cars

When considering the average price of a 2025 4-door Chevy car, it’s essential to understand the multiple factors that can influence the cost. Firstly, the model of the car plays a significant role in determining its price. Chevy offers a wide range of models, each with its own unique features and specifications. Higher-end models, such as the Chevy Impala or the Chevy Malibu, tend to be more expensive than more basic models like the Chevy Spark.

Another crucial factor is the car’s trim level. Most Chevy models offer several different trims, each with varying levels of luxury, performance, and technological features. Naturally, higher trim levels come with a heftier price tag. Similarly, optional extras such as upgraded infotainment systems, advanced safety features, and premium materials for the interior can also add to the overall cost of the car.

The location of purchase is another factor that can influence the price of a Chevy car. Dealerships in different regions may have differing prices due to factors such as local demand, competition, and taxes. Additionally, the time of purchase can also affect the car’s price. For instance, dealerships often offer discounts towards the end of the year or during sales events to move inventory.

Lastly, the overall economic climate can influence car prices. Factors such as inflation, exchange rates, and the cost of raw materials can all impact the manufacturer’s suggested retail price (MSRP).

The Impact of Car Features and Specifications on Price

The specific features and specifications of a car can significantly impact its price. This holds true for the 2025 4-door Chevy cars as well. The base price of a car model typically includes a standard set of features and specifications, but any enhancements or upgrades can increase the cost.

For instance, a car with a larger engine or one that offers superior fuel efficiency might be priced higher. Similarly, specific tech features such as advanced infotainment systems, navigation systems, safety features like lane departure warning, adaptive cruise control, and blind-spot detection can also add to the price of the car.

The interior of the car also plays a crucial role in determining its price. Higher-end materials like leather seats, or features like heated seats or a sunroof can make the car more expensive. Similarly, exterior enhancements like special paint jobs or larger wheel sizes can also increase the price.
